Transaction 807fefa70e6ac3c7a74141e66c2e84631f7219e81efd01de99e0834a2534d392

2 Input
2 Outputs
  • 807fefa70e6ac3c7a74141e66c2e84631f7219e81efd01de99e0834a2534d392:0
  • value  8239560
    address  32qd1fedx4tTwnW6837NHU4AcWRNEzM6jV
  • 807fefa70e6ac3c7a74141e66c2e84631f7219e81efd01de99e0834a2534d392:1
  • value  425500
    address  12UB61mZVxjB9ouD3yGvpNjtCkBhDNdpJJ